      The author describes the development of acoustics as related to the research of Ernst Florens Friedrich Chladni (1756-1827). His brief biography of Chladni reveals the extent to which Chladni was interested in the construction of musical instruments and in the theories of harmony. The article shows how the new theories of musical composition and the progress in the construction of musical instruments stimulated experimental research on acoustics. He notes in conclusion, however, that violin makers made less use of the new results than might be expected and he suggests that the relationship between the study of acoustics and the design of musical instruments needs further research.
